Troubleshooting Common SMTP Server Issues

Experiencing setbacks with your mail sending? Common SMTP platform errors can be irritating , but often straightforward to correct. Here's a guide at frequent obstacles and how to handle them. First, double-check your SMTP parameters, including the hostname , port , and copyright. Incorrect credentials are a primary cause of problems . Next, check authentication problems ; ensure your code is correct and that multi-factor authentication, if enabled , is working . You can also confirm your access using a standard email application like Thunderbird . Finally, review your originating IP score; poor reputations can trigger blocks by receiving systems.

  • Check SMTP authentication.
  • Inspect your IP standing .
  • Use a test email program .
  • Audit SMTP records for insights .

Secure Your Emails: Best Practices for SMTP Configuration

Protecting your email communications is absolutely important in today's digital landscape. Properly establishing your Simple Mail Transfer Protocol (SMTP) server is smtp server a key step. Start by enabling TLS or SSL encryption to safeguard data during transit. Use strong passwords for your SMTP accounts and regularly rotate them. Consider requiring multi-factor verification for an enhanced layer of protection . Finally, review your SMTP logs for suspicious behavior and apply rate restrictions to avoid abuse. This method will significantly improve your email reliability.
